Summary

Roper Technologies posted Q2 2026 revenue of $2.11 billion (+9% YoY) and adjusted EPS of $5.38 (+10%), raised full-year guidance, and repurchased $1.2 billion in shares.


Key Events · Earnings and Guidance · ROP

  • Q2 Revenue +9% to $2.11B

    Total revenue grew 9% year-over-year to $2.11 billion, with organic growth of 5% and a 3% contribution from acquisitions.

  • Adjusted EPS +10% to $5.38

    Adjusted diluted EPS rose 10% to $5.38, driven by revenue growth and margin expansion; GAAP DEPS was $11.62, inflated by an $835M non-cash gain on the Indicor minority investment.

  • $1.2B Share Repurchase in Q2

    Roper repurchased 3.6 million shares for $1.2 billion in Q2, bringing the cumulative buyback to 9.0 million shares for $3.2 billion over three quarters, reducing shares outstanding to 2013 levels.

  • Full-Year Guidance Raised

    Full-year 2026 adjusted DEPS guidance increased to $22.15–$22.30 from $21.80–$22.05, with the total revenue growth outlook raised to 8%+ and organic growth to ~6%.


Analysis · ROP · Industrial Applications And Services

A solid quarter for Roper featured 9% revenue growth and a 10% increase in adjusted EPS, fueled by broad-based strength across its software and tech-enabled products segments. During Q2 the company repurchased $1.2 billion in shares, bringing the cumulative buyback to $3.2 billion over three quarters and shrinking the share count to 2013 levels. Management raised full-year adjusted EPS guidance to $22.15–$22.30, above the prior range, and initiated Q3 guidance of $5.75–$5.80. The results and guidance raise signal durable demand and effective capital deployment, though the large non-cash gain from the Indicor minority investment distorts GAAP earnings.
